The cheapest way to get from Figueres to Els Límits is to drive which costs €3 - €6 and takes 25 min.
The fastest way to get from Figueres to Els Límits is to taxi which takes 25 min and costs €35 - €45.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Figures and arriving at El Portús. Services depart three times a day,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 40 min.
The distance between Figueres and Els Límits is 25 km. The road distance is 24.6 km.
The best way to get from Figueres to Els Límits without a car is to bus which takes 40 min and costs €3 - €9.
The bus from Figures to El Portús takes 40 min including transfers and departs three times a day.
Figueres to Els Límits bus services, operated by Transports Elèctrics Interurbans S.A., depart from Figures station.
Figueres to Els Límits bus services, operated by Transports Elèctrics Interurbans S.A., arrive at El Portús station.
Yes, the driving distance between Figueres to Els Límits is 25 km. It takes approximately 25 min to drive from Figueres to Els Límits.
